Mt. Lebanon School is a school servicing grades PK to 4 and is located in the district of "Lebanon School District" in Lebanon, NH. There are a total of 247 students and 40 teachers at Mt. Lebanon School, for a student to teacher ratio of 7 to 1.

Mt. Lebanon School has an average proficiency test score (in mathematics and languages) of 59.5%, which is 14% higher than the New Hampshire average.

The proficiency in math and languages tables represent the percentage of students that scored at or above the proficiency level on their standardized state assessment tests. Although these tests are standardized within each state, the tests may vary from state to state. Comparing the results of one state to another may not always be an accurate or fair comparison.
